30 Next Moses placed the washbasin between
the Tabernacle and the altar. He filled it with
water so the priests could wash themselves.
31 Moses and Aaron and Aaron’s sons used water
from it to wash their hands and feet. 32 Whenever they approached the altar and entered the
Tabernacle, they washed themselves, just as the
Lord had commanded Moses.
33 Then he hung the curtains forming the
courtyard around the Tabernacle and the altar.
And he set up the curtain at the entrance of the
courtyard. So at last Moses finished the work.

The LORD’s Glory Fills the Tabernacle
34 Then the cloud covered the Tabernacle, and
the glory of the Lord filled the Tabernacle.
35 Moses could no longer enter the Tabernacle
because the cloud had settled down over it, and
the glory of the Lord filled the Tabernacle.
36 Now whenever the cloud lifted from the
Tabernacle, the people of Israel would set out
on their journey, following it. 37 But if the cloud
did not rise, they remained where they were
until it lifted. 38 The cloud of the Lord hovered
over the Tabernacle during the day, and at night
fire glowed inside the cloud so the whole family
of Israel could see it. This continued throughout
all their journeys.
